Perfect Square
535966841954062091533321 is a perfect square (732097563139 × 732097563139)
535966841954062091533321 is a perfect square (732097563139 × 732097563139)
535966841954062091533321 is odd
Previous odd number is 535966841954062091533319
Next odd number is 535966841954062091533323
1110001011111101101001000011010110010110011000000010111111000011011110000001001
153962079245991476890651392949742178275664744278157738485141713695635161